  • the invention relates to radiation protection clothing for shielding radiation, which is emitted by a radiation source, in particular an X-ray source, according to the preamble of claim 1.
  • a radiation protection jacket which has at least one Velcro strip on a lower layer and a corresponding Velcro strip on the upper layer of the radiation protection clothing, wherein the corresponding Velcro strips overlap at least partially when the radiation protection clothing is worn by a person.
  • the radiation protection clothing comprises an at least partially elastic belt, which also has Velcro strips at its ends, which allow the attachment of the belt around the hips of the radiation protective clothing wearer.
  • an X-ray apron which comprises a front part and two backs and a closure for holding the backs, wherein at each back a band is attached, at its end a Velcro closure layer is, and complementary Velcro layers the apron are provided, on which the Velcro layers at the end portions of the bands after they are crosswise guided over the other back part, for the purpose of producing an adhesive bond can be placed.
  • the complementary Velcro closure layers for the Velcro layer of each band are arranged on the other back part.
  • the known garment comprises a front and a back part, a shoulder part to hang the garment on a user, and an elastic belt, which is preferably attached to the garment at the waist or waist.
  • the object of the present invention is to provide a radiation protection clothing in which Velcro parts can be exchanged in a simple manner and which ensures a reliable protection against radiation.
  • Velcro fasteners which are located in the end region of fastening straps of the radiation protection clothing, for example, with zippers, snaps or snap fasteners can be fixed to the radiation protection clothing. Since these straps are usually in a range of radiation protection clothing, which is not relevant radiation absorption technology, can be fixed to the fastening straps in a simple way rivets, zippers or snap buckles and the complementary Velcro parts.
  • the complementary Velcro fastener parts can also be arranged on the surface of the radiation protection clothing, for example by means of zippers, in such a way that they are interchangeable even in areas which are relevant to radiation without impairing the safety of the radiation protection clothing.
  • Velcro fastener parts by means of another Velcro fastener connection, wherein one of the complementary Velcro fastener parts is attached to the surface of the radiation protective clothing and on it a double-sided Velcro part is placed at these positions. Since the bottom velcro is rarely opened and closed, the adhesive force is very high, so that a secure fixation is given with easy interchangeability.
  • Fig. 1A and 1B show a first exemplary radiation protective clothing 1, which comprises a front part 2, which shields the body of the wearer from the shoulders to about knee height against ionizing radiation, and fastening straps 3.
  • Radiation protection clothing of this type is used in particular for the shielding of X-rays in the surgical and diagnostic field of clinics and medical practices.
  • the radiation protection clothing 1 has in the present embodiment, two straps 3, which are placed over the shoulders of the wearer, crossed behind the back and by means of complementary Velcro fastener parts 4, which are fixed to the fastening straps 3 and the front part 2 in corresponding positions, are attached.
  • the complementary Velcro parts 4 are attached to the radiation protection clothing 1, that the protective function against the radiation remains unaffected.
  • the lead-containing layer of radiation protection clothing 1 serving for shielding is not penetrated by seams, rivets or the like.
  • an exemplary radiation protection clothing 1 is a so-called tooth part 4b of the complementary Velcro parts 4 arranged laterally on the front part 2 of the radiation protection clothing 1 and a so-called wool part 4b of the complementary Velcro parts 4 fixed to the ends of the fastening bands 3.
  • the complementary Velcro parts 4 are arranged so that they overlap at least partially and thereby apply a holding force which is large enough to fix the radiation protection clothing 1 securely on the carrier.

  • At least one elastic zone 5 is provided in the shoulders of the wearer, which allows a limited stretching of the fastening bands 3.
  • Fig. 1C are zippers 6 are provided at various positions of the radiation protection clothing, which can be arranged for example in the end region of the fastening bands 3 or in the shoulder region of the radiation protection clothing 1.
  • fastening straps 3 is shown as the simplest fastening measure a zipper 6, through which the located at the back of the fastening tape 3 wool part 4a of the complementary Velcro parts 4 is connected to the end of the fastening tape 3 releasably connected to the radiation protection clothing 1.
  • the zipper 6 is opened, which removes the wool part 4 a part of the fastening tape 3 and through replaced a new one.
  • both the elastic zones 5 are claimed by frequent use and in particular by the not inconsiderable weight of the radiation protection clothing 1 and thereby lose their elasticity with time, it is under It may be desirable to exchange both the velcro velcro parts 4 and the elastic zones 5 together.
  • a corresponding arrangement is Fig. 1C to remove the right of the two straps 3.
  • both the elastic zone 5 and the zipper 6 can be arranged at an arbitrary position of the fastening band 3.
  • FIG. 1D Another possibility of attachment of the Velcro part 4 having the end of the fastening strap 3 is shown.
  • the attachment of at least one, preferably several snaps 7 is taken.
  • an upper part of the push buttons 7 is fastened to one side of the fastening band 3, for example by riveting, while the counterpart of the push buttons 7 are located on the releasably connectable part of the fastening band 3 with the Velcro fastener part 4. If necessary, the snaps are simply opened and a new end of the fastening tape 3 with the corresponding snaps buttoned again.
  • the Fig. 1E and 1F show a further fastening means of snap fasteners 8, which in Fig. 1E in open and in Fig. 1F are shown in the closed state.
  • the connection is performed by 2 snap fasteners 8.
  • the snap buckles 8 are released by squeezing lateral legs of the buckles 8a in the closure parts 8b.
  • a corresponding new end with closure parts 8b fastened thereto can be connected to the fastening strap 3 by means of simple attachment of the closure parts 8b to the buckles 8a.
  • Particularly advantageous in this embodiment is the ability to integrate the elastic zones 5 in fastening tabs 9 of the snap buckles 8 by the fastening tabs 9 are made of elastic material.
  • FIGS. 2A and 2B show a further exemplary radiation protection clothing 1 in a relation to the in Fig. 1 shown radiation protection clothing modified embodiment.
  • FIG. 2A While the front part 2 of in Fig. 2A illustrated radiation protection jacket 1 in about that in Fig. 1 is equal to, is from the back view in Fig. 2B It can be seen that, due to the protective function required by the back parts 10 of the radiation protection clothing 1, the fastening straps 3, which can be made interchangeable, are shorter. In order to ensure the protective function of the back parts 10, the elastic zones 5 and the zippers 6 must be arranged relatively close to one another in the end region of the fastening straps 3. In Fig. 2B are again exemplified zippers 6 shown for releasable connection. It can, however, as in the Fig. 1C to 1F also push buttons 7 or snap buckles 8 are used for releasable connection.
  • the front part 2 of the radiation protection clothing 1 in turn has two hook and loop fastener parts 4, which in the present embodiment in the tooth parts 4b exist, on which the wool parts 4a are placed on the back parts 10 of the radiation protection clothing 1 for attachment.
  • a circumferential zipper 6 or a double-sided Velcro part can be used for releasable connection of the tooth parts 4b turn.
  • the hook-and-loop fastener part 4 can be sewn, sewn or riveted onto a textile cover 11 enveloping the radiation protection layer without impairing the radiation protection function of the radiation protection layer.
  • FIGS. 3A and 3B is a radiation protection clothing 1 for the protection of the thyroid and the sternum, which is also referred to as Sternumschutz 12 shown.
  • Fig. 3A shows the sternum protection 12 in the applied state, wherein a push button strip 13 is provided, for example, for fixing the Sternumschutzes 12 at another part of the radiation protection clothing 1.
  • the complementary hook-and-loop fastener parts 4, in particular the wool part 4a, can in turn be connected to the sternum protector 12 by various measures.
  • the right fastening band 3 in Fig. 3B is provided with a zipper 6, while the left mounting band 3 in Fig. 3B has a series of snaps 7. Also the fixation by means of in Fig. 1E and 1F shown snap fasteners 8 is conceivable. Also, to improve the fit elastic zones 5 may be arranged at any point of the fastening bands 3. These can be designed so that they are interchangeable with the complementary Velcro parts 4.
  • the variant of the attachment would offer by means of a double-sided Velcro closure part, after the Sternumschutz 12 is relatively small and therefore relatively light. As a result, excessive weight loading of the Velcro connection is avoided and ensures a particularly easy replacement.
  • the invention is not limited to the illustrated embodiments and, for example, for any radiation protective clothing such as full-body shields for infants, dental aprons or the like applicable.

Claims (17)

  1.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1) pour le blindage d'un rayonnement émis par une source de rayonnement, en particulier un rayonnement X, avec des parties de fermeture Velcro (4) complémentaires pour le blocage du v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1),
    dans lequel les parties de fermeture Velcro (4) complémentaires se composent respectivement d'une partie en laine (4a) et d'une partie dentée (4b) et sont disposées sur le v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1) de sorte qu'elles puissent être placées l'une sur l'autre afin d'établir une liaison adhésive pour la fermeture du v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1),
    et dans lequel au moins l'une des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ires est reliée de manière amovible au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1), caractérisé en ce que
    les coutures des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) ne sont pas réalisées au travers d'une couche de protection contre les rayonnements du v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  2.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 1,
    caractérisé en ce que
    la partie en laine (4a) des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ires est reliée de manière amovible au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  3.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 1 ou 2,
    caractérisé en ce que
    la partie dentée (4b) des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ires est reliée de manière amovible au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  4.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que
    les par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ires sont reliées de manière amovible au moyen d'au moins une fermeture Eclair (6) au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  5.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 4,
    caractérisé en ce que
    la fermeture Eclair (6) s'étend de manière périphérique autour des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ires reliées au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  6.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que
    les par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ires sont reliées de manière amovible au moyen de boutons-pressions (7) au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  7.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que
    les par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ires sont reliées de manière amovible au moyen de fermetures à boucle à déclic (8) également complémentaires au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  8.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que
    les par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ires sont reliées de manière amovible au moyen de parties de fermeture Velcro également complémentaires au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  9.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 8, caractérisé en ce que
    l'une des parties de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) complémentaires est montée sur au moins une bande de fixation (3) qui est reliée au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  10.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 9,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ins une bande de fixation (3) présente au moins un insert (5) élastique.
  11.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 9 ou 10,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ins une bande de fixation (3) avec la partie de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) est reliée de manière amovible au moyen d'une fermeture Eclair (6) au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  12.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 9 ou 10,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ins une bande de fixation (3) avec la partie de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) est reliée de manière amovible au moyen de boutons-pressions (7) au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  13.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 9 ou 10,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ins une bande de fixation (3) est reliée avec la partie de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) de manière amovible au moyen d'au moins une fermeture à boucle à déclic (8) au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  14.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 13,
    caractérisé en ce que
    les zones (5) élastiques sont formées par des languettes de fixation (9) des fermetures à boucle à déclic (8).
  15.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on la revendication 9 ou 10,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ins une bande de fixation (3) avec la partie de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b) est reliée de manière amovible au moyen d'une partie de fermeture Velcro complémentaire double face au v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
  16. Vêtement de protection selon la revendication 10, caractérisé en ce que
    l'au moins un insert (5) élastique est interchangeable conjointement avec la partie de fermeture Velcro (4 ; 4a ; 4b).
  17. V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ements selon l'une quelconque des revendications 5 à 7, caractérisé en ce que
    des coutures des fermetures Eclair (6), des boutons-pressions (7) et des fermetures à boucle à déclic (8) ne sont pas réalisées au travers de la couche de protection contre les rayonnements du vêtement de protection contre les rayonnements (1).
